Examples
“The skin-group, or “yiminga” of a Tiwi is matrilineal; it is inherited from the mother and determines the marriage line.”
“In Walbiri society you belong⟳ to one of these eight skin-groups. They dominate your social life; they determine⟳ who you can marry⟳, and they determine⟳ how you relate⟳ to everybody else in Walbiri society.”
